SME Tax Intensive Case Studies: Session One
Published on 18 Apr 2002 | Took place at Leonda by the Yarra, Hawthorn, VIC
The SME sector continues to be subject to intense pressure from the changing Australian tax landscape. In this first of a two-part series, case studies are used to examine CGT issues impacting small business and tax issues for business sellers.

CGT issues for small business: case studies
Author(s):
John POINTON
This seminar paper discusses CGT issues for small business, with a focus on: structuring for the small business CGT concessions, CGT planning strategies, application of the CGT discount rule, CGT implications for trusts, practical tips and traps.

Tax issues for business sellers
Author(s):
Graeme HALPERIN
This seminar paper discusses tax issues for business sellers, with a focus on: earn-out rights post-Dulux, trust takeovers, price allocation, tax warranties and indemnities, common mistakes with CGT concessions.
